ALEXANDRIA, LA – The (RV) Louisiana State University of Alexandria men's soccer team travels to North American University and Texas A&M-Victoria in a pair of Red River Athletic Conference road matches.

THE GENERALS
Ben McCarron scored a pair of goals last week, and
Paul Adler tallied three assists, as the Generals improved to 10-0-1 in RRAC play.
Adler and Pablo Dominguez de Leon are tied for the team lead in goals, assists, and points (5G, 5A, 15TP).
Ivan Capurro has recorded 28 saves and four clean sheets.
SCOUTING NORTH AMERICAN
North American University is 4-5-1 on the season and 3-3-1 in RRAC play. They won their last match against Texas College, 2-0.
The Stallions have scored 18 goals and allowed 18. They average 1.80 goals per game and goals against per game. Sandile Mdluli leads NAU with four goals and nine points.
Gino Burioni has made eight starts in goal. He has allowed 14 goals and made 26 saves. Burioni has a goals against average of 1.89.
LSUA is 2-0-0 all-time against North American University. They earned a 5-0 victory on the road last season.
SCOUTING A&M VICTORIA
The game between the Generals and Jaguars has been selected as the RRAC Game of the Week. The Jaguars enter the week with a record of 7-5-1 overall and 3-2-1 in RRAC play. The have won their last two matches.
A&M Victoria has recorded 25 goals and allowed 22. They average 1.89 goals per game and 1.69 goals against per game.
Jervan Matthew has a team-high eight goals and 19 points. Tyler Kaepelli has started all 13 games in goal and has made 29 saves and allowed 16 goals.
LSUA is 5-5-1 against A&M-Victoria. The Generals are 2-2 on the road, including aa 3-0 victory last season.
